Personal Support Worker
3 weeks ago
_At AON's _**Moira Place Long Term Care Home,**_ _located in Tweed, our caring and highly skilled staff promotes family and community involvement to enrich the lives of our residents. What sets us apart is our service and our commitment to "Care" in everything we do._ **Full-Time & Part-Time work schedules** **Eligibility for a signing bonus** **This PSW position is part of the Return of Service initiative where upon completion of 6 months service, PSWs may be eligible to receive $5,000 (paid out in 2 installments). Eligibility determined by HealthForce Ontario.** We are seeking motivated and passionate **Personal Support Workers** at AON's Moira Place long-term care home As a foundational part of our highly skilled and multi-disciplinary team, you will assist our residents in their activities of daily living by providing skilled care in an empathetic and nurturing manner. **Responsibilities**: - Provide hands-on compassionate delivery of skilled services to residents in the provision of care with adherence to confidentiality, privacy, and a focus on maintaining dignity. - Assist residents with the personal care required for daily living including personal hygiene, elimination, nutrition, functional mobility and mobilization, and other emotional and social aspects of life. - Perform resident-specific care according to plans of care and established restorative care guidelines as outlined by the Director of Care. - Participation in care planning while motivating and encouraging residents’ participation in programs to maintain and enhance independence. - Ensure clear and effective communication in the process of assessments, observations, and documentation of residents’ physical and emotional conditions in accordance with company policy and regulatory requirements. **Qualifications**: - Must possess a valid PSW certificate or be in the second year of the RPN / RN program. - Prior experience in a retirement or long term care environment preferred - Must have strong communication and interpersonal skills and be a team player. - Must be available to work varied shifts. **Why Choose AON's LTC?** - Top-quartile waitlist performance - Early adopter of adult Montessori concepts, with best-in-class restorative care program - Opportunities for career growth and professional development - Leading edge health care technology - Fully accredited, with leading compliance results in the region - Home-like work environment, with carpeted hallways and no overhead paging systems - A pacesetter in adopting long-term care Best Practices - The first in-Home Peritoneal Dialysis program in the region - With operations in both Canada and the U.S. and a 50+ year tradition of quality and customer service, AON is the region’s largest privately owned employer._ - AON Inc. is committed to meet the accessibility needs of persons with disabilities as part of our hiring process.
